About Lemon Tree
Lemon Tree from Barneys Farm is a Hybrid cannabis strain created from a cross between Lemon Skunk and Sour Diesel. These autoflowering seeds are intended for adult collectors and growers in regions where cultivation is legally permitted.
This strain is known for its distinctive lemon and sour character combined with classic Diesel and skunky notes. Lemon Tree seeds are described as having strong THC levels, so growers often approach this variety with care and attention to growing conditions.
Key details
- Strain type: Hybrid
- Genetics: A cross between Lemon Skunk and Sour Diesel
- Seed type: Auto
- Flowering time: Typically around 9–10 weeks from germination to harvest
- THC: Reported as strong

🌱 Growing Cannabis Seeds – Common Questions
💧 How do I soak cannabis seeds before planting?
Place the seeds in a glass of cold tap water or rainwater and keep the glass in a dark place. Wait between 2 and 10 days until the seeds begin to sprout.
🌿 How deep should I plant germinated seeds?
Plant sprouted seeds about 0.5 cm deep in light, moist soil with the root pointing down. Handle gently to avoid damaging the sprout.
💧 How moist should the soil be for seedlings?
Keep the soil evenly moist but never soaked. Overwatering can drown young seedlings. A small propagator helps maintain humidity.
⚠️ What are common mistakes when growing cannabis seeds?
❌ Soil that’s too wet – the seedling may rot.
❌ Planting too deep – the seedling may not reach the surface.
Always ensure good drainage and shallow planting.
🌱 Do I need special soil or pots for growing?
Use seed-raising or herb soil and pots with drainage holes so excess water can escape. This prevents root rot and promotes healthy growth.

📌 Important Legal Notes:
- New South Wales (NSW), Queensland (QLD), Western Australia (WA), and South Australia (SA): Cannabis cultivation is generally illegal without a medical licence or government exemption.
- Australian Capital Territory (ACT): Adults may grow up to two plants per person (maximum four per household) for personal use, subject to strict rules (plants must not be visible from public areas, and sharing or selling is prohibited).
- Victoria (VIC) & Tasmania (TAS): Cannabis cultivation is illegal without proper authorisation.
- Seed possession: Cannabis seed laws often fall into a legal grey area – possession may not always be illegal, but germination and cultivation typically are unless permitted under a licensed medical program.
